From Gaudi to Le Corbusier, this examines the relationship between ecology and architecture.Since time immemorial, bees have been associated with all manner of virtues. The beehive has served as the model for an ideal society, as well as the basis for positive metaphors of productivity. In this book, the author shows how it influenced the artists who founded the Modern movement.
